Entertainment Weekly's Record-Breaking 15 Covers featuring Avengers: Infinity War

The latest issue of Entertainment Weekly features 15 commemorative covers and 22 superheroes (plus one villain), to celebrate the upcoming movie Avengers: Infinity War, which will be the 19th film in the Marvel Cinematic Universe. Executive Editor, Tim Leong, said that it took almost a year to plan; when all the covers are combined into one bigger image (see above), it showcases the Avengers logo.  Keir Novesky, EW's Design Director, executed the cover design. This is the most covers Entertainment Weekly has put together for one issue in its 28-year history, setting a new record for the publication. The two issues that tie for the second most covers produced were 11 covers for both Lost in 2010 and True Blood in 2012. All 15 covers were exclusively revealed yesterday morning on Good Morning America.
